Our bodies are not weak things that, as soon as something happens, shut down. We should really cherish our bodies because they\u2019re so much stronger than we think,\u201d said <a href=\"http:\/\/athletics.biola.edu\/roster.aspx?rp_id=2846\" target=\"_blank\"><strong>Thomine Mortensen<\/strong><\/a>, a varsity swimmer at Biola University.<\/p>\n<p>Far too often, female swimmers limit themselves by believing lies about their capabilities and value as athletes. They compare themselves to their female and male teammates. They feel pressured to conform to culture\u2019s ideal physical standards, and they buy into the lie that athleticism and femininity are not supposed to be connected.<\/p>\n<p>Vollmer probably did not set out to oppose these beliefs with her swim, but she did. She gave the world an image of a woman fully embracing and celebrating her body as it is.<\/p>\n<p>She recognized that she had just as much of a right to compete at that meet as all the other swimmers there, even though none of her competitors were as pregnant as her&#8230;or pregnant at all. Vollmer also didn\u2019t believe that her race goals were any less valid than the goals set by her competitors just because they were set on different achievements.<\/p>\n<p>In an <a href=\"https:\/\/www.swimmingworldmagazine.com\/news\/video-interview-dana-vollmer-having-a-boy-discusses-racing-pregnant\/\" target=\"_blank\">interview<\/a>\u00a0shortly after her 50 free, Vollmer commented on her race: \u201c\u2018Time didn\u2019t matter, place didn\u2019t matter,\u2019 she said. \u2018I\u2019ve loved being here. I\u2019ve loved seeing all my teammates, all the people from Rio. The race felt great.\u2019\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Vollmer was able to race because she set her goals for herself and didn\u2019t play the comparison game. Female athletes see the girls standing up on the podium and think: \u201cif only I could be leaner, or taller, I could win that medal too.\u201d On one hand not all physical goals are unhealthy. Setting seasonal goals of lifting heavier or eating healthier aren&#8217;t bad. Goals become unhealthy when a swimmer ignores the reality of who she is while setting them.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/athletics.biola.edu\/staff.aspx?staff=127\" target=\"_blank\"><strong>Eddie Shephard<\/strong><\/a>, Associate Athletic Director at Biola Univeristy and former head swim and dive coach, has watched many female student-athletes struggle while chasing after ideals.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cAn athlete also has to have realistic goals. Goals that are consistent with the level of performance that a particular swimmer is capable of, but that are also going to allow that person to strive to become better,\u201d Shephard said.<\/p>\n<p>Goals are meant to motivate and challenge, but if they\u2019re based on ideals that are impossible to reach they will only lead to frustration and discouragement.<\/p>\n<p>Unfortunately, overcoming the comparison struggle isn\u2019t as easy as resetting goals. Female swimmers not only need to stop comparing themselves to the other athletes around them, but they also need to be able to look at their bodies and appreciate them as they are.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cBody types are established primarily by genetics, although I have far too often seen females allow that to get the best of them and limit their potential in a negative way. It is important to understand your body type and accept that it will change, but it does not always have to be seen as a negative thing and or a reason to stop or expect less of yourself,\u201d said <a href=\"http:\/\/athletics.biola.edu\/staff.aspx?staff=215\" target=\"_blank\"><strong>Emily Mosbacher<\/strong><\/a>, head swim and dive coach at Biola University.<\/p>\n<p>A wise swimmer will try to have the healthiest body she can. She won\u2019t try to have what she believes to be the perfect body.<\/p>\n<p>Mosbacher believes the female swimmer who takes a genuine look at her body and does the work to figure out what she needs to reach a competitive fitness level will succeed&#8211;<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e can encourage girls to embrace their bodies by educating them on healthy living and finding their personal strengths within their God-given bodies. If someone is a talented athlete, she should embrace her gifts as an athlete and her ability to compete rather than focusing on achieving a specific shape or look.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Instead of setting goals to achieve the ideal swimming body, Mosbacher encourages girls to \u201cfocus on the love of the sport, the fun of the competition, and healthy living.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Vollmer\u2019s swim reminded girls that they need to focus on themselves when assessing their athletic achievements.
